After-hours and pre-market trading may carry slightly higher risks than regular market hours. As issuers often announce important financial information outside regular trading hours, extended-hours trading may result in wider spreads for a particular security. That is because extended-hours trading may result in lower liquidity and higher volatility.

Dividend

Paying dividends generates immediate cash flow for investors and indicates a positive outlook for the company. Hormel Foods Corp. pays an annual dividend of $1.12, resulting in a dividend yield of 3.46%, and it has a price to earnings (P/E) ratio of 22.76. HRL’s most recent ex-dividend date was 7/15/2024 when it declared a $0.2825 quarterly dividend that was paid in cash on 8/15/2024. Previously, the company paid the dividend on 5/15/2024 with an ex-dividend date of 4/12/2024. The HRL stock dividend was $0.2825 per share in cash.

Balance Sheet Annually/Quarterly

An organization’s balance sheet depicts the assets and liabilities it has, as well as the amount of equity invested. Investors can measure a company’s prospects by calculating its financial ratios using this information. HRL’s latest balance sheet shows that the firm has $634.69M in Cash & Short Term Investments as of fiscal 2021. There were $3.32B in debt and $1.42B in liabilities at the time. Its Book Value Per Share was $14.35, while its Total Shareholder’s Equity was $6.98B.
